Primary income balance (credit less debit), Net (credits less debits) in Antigua and Barbuda
Antigua and Barbuda: Primary income balance (credit less debit), Net (credits less debits) was -109.59 million in 2024. ▼ Falling
Primary income balance (credit less debit), Net (credits less debits) in Antigua and Barbuda, 2005–2024
Source: International Monetary Fund.
Analysis
In 2024, primary income balance (credit less debit), net (credits less debits) in Antigua and Barbuda stood at -109.59 million. That is the lowest value across all 20 years on record.
Compared with earlier readings it is down 29.8% on the previous year and down 80.4% over ten years.
Over the whole period, primary income balance (credit less debit), net (credits less debits) in Antigua and Barbuda peaked at 816,537 in 2020 and was at its lowest, -109.59 million, in 2024.
Antigua and Barbuda ranks 70th of 197 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.
The long-run direction has been consistently falling across the 20 years of available data.
Primary income balance (credit less debit), Net (credits less debits) in Antigua and Barbuda, year by year
| Year | Value | Change |
|---|---|---|
| 2005 | -54.97 million | — |
| 2006 | -63.25 million | +15.1% |
| 2007 | -73.22 million | +15.8% |
| 2008 | -72.58 million | -0.9% |
| 2009 | -68.03 million | -6.3% |
| 2010 | -67.58 million | -0.7% |
| 2011 | -70.28 million | +4.0% |
| 2012 | -86.76 million | +23.5% |
| 2013 | -70.31 million | -19.0% |
| 2014 | -60.73 million | -13.6% |
| 2015 | -84.54 million | +39.2% |
| 2016 | -97.40 million | +15.2% |
| 2017 | -76.15 million | -21.8% |
| 2018 | -77.06 million | +1.2% |
| 2019 | -71.69 million | -7.0% |
| 2020 | 816,537 | -101.1% |
| 2021 | -57.29 million | -7115.9% |
| 2022 | -92.69 million | +61.8% |
| 2023 | -84.42 million | -8.9% |
| 2024 | -109.59 million | +29.8% |

About this data
The World and Country Group Aggregates (historically called BOPSY) is an annual publication, released each November, of major balance of payments and international investment position components for countries, country groups, and the world.
